-If you set this function on, you can control the starting and ending time of recording by special signal included in the broadcasting signal.

If a TV program is shortened or starts earlier or later than scheduled, this function synchronizes the starting and ending time of recording with the actual broadcasting time automatically.

-Set up the start-time EXACTLY according to the published TV schedule. Otherwise the timer recording will not take place.

-Do not select PDC or VPS unless you are sure the program you wish to record is broadcast with PDC or VPS.

Mode (Recording Mode)

-FR: Select when you want to set video quality automatically. It depends on the remaining time on the DVD.

-XP (high quality): Select when audio and video qualities are important. (Approx. 1 hour)

-SP (standard quality): Select to record in standard quality. (Approx. 2 hours)

-LP (low quality): Select when a long recording time is required. (Approx. 4 hours)

-EP (extended mode): Select when a longer recording time is required. (Approx.6 hours)
